3 | Tremper defeated Indian Trail 7-3 thanks to a strong start. Tremper scored on a single by Nathan Renner in the first inning and a double by Alex Moyao in the second inning. Tremper scored three runs in the sixth inning on a home run by Mitchell Buban. Kyle Humphres earned the win for Tremper Baseball. He tossed four innings, allowing one run, five hits, and striking out two. Hunter Weddel recorded the last nine outs to earn the save. Tremper Baseball had ten hits in the game. Weddel and Eddie Makar each collected two hits. | ||||

7 | Chippewa Falls took the lead for good in the seventh inning to capture a back-and-forth game from EauClaire Memorial by a 7-5 score on Thursday. The game was tied at five with Chippewa Falls batting in the top of the seventh when Bryce Harder doubled off of Jack Brown, driving in two runs. Bryce Harder went 1-for-4 at the plate as he led the team with two runs batted in. | ||||

10 | St. Joseph Lancers and St. Catherine's played a tight affair on Thursday, but the Lancers prevailed 8-7 after taking the lead in the eighth inning. The game was tied at seven with St. Joseph batting in the top of the eighth when Javon Connolly singled, driving in one run. Connolly and Kyle Matrise each had three hits to lead St. Joseph Lancers. | ||||
